Supporting Students


PG’s non-profit arm, Pooni Group Foundation, is proud to announce a brand-new scholarship. The Thunderbird Award for IBPOC students will offer up $10,000 annually for student athletes on any varsity team who are Indigenous or who identify as Black or as a Person of Colour, with preference given to student athletes who identify as South Asian.


Pooni Group is thrilled to partner with UBC athletics on this initiative. Among its many accomplishments, the province’s biggest university boasts 26 varsity teams representing men’s and women’s sports; is home to more than 225 Olympians; and has had 100+ athletes drafted into professional leagues. UBC Athletics strives to create a welcoming and empowering space where IBPOC individuals can thrive, achieve their full potential, and contribute meaningfully to the university community and beyond.
